Compliance Needs and Adherence

Registered agents are bound by a range of compliance standards and statutory requirements that differ by jurisdiction. Each region mandates that companies appoint a registered agent to receive official papers and public notifications on their behalf. This function is essential for ensuring that a company preserves its good standing and adheres to local laws. Failure to comply with these conditions can lead to penalties, including the loss of the company’s ability to conduct business within the state.

In addition to being available during standard business hours, designated representatives must also maintain a physical address within the state of registration. Cost Factors for Registered Agents

When selecting a registered agent, understanding the cost implications is essential for business owners. Registered agent services can differ widely in cost, depending on factors such as where of the business, the provider's reputation, and the variety of services offered. Basic registered agent fees usually cover essential functions like receiving and delivering legal documents, but extra services like compliance reminders or annual report filings may incur extra costs.
